Crate kvdb

source ·
Expand description

Key-Value store abstraction.

Structs

Write transaction. Batches a sequence of put/delete operations for efficiency.
Statistic for the span period

Enums

Database operation.
Statistic kind to query.

Constants

Required length of prefixes.

Traits

Generic key-value database.

Functions

For a given start prefix (inclusive), returns the correct end prefix (non-inclusive). This assumes the key bytes are ordered in lexicographical order. Since key length is not limited, for some case we return None because there is no bounded limit (every keys in the serie [], [255], [255, 255] …).

Type Definitions

Database keys.
A tuple holding key and value data, used in the iterator item type.
Database value.